The shamrock is the best known symbol of Ireland and St. Patrick's Day. Shamrock comes from the Irish Gaelic word Seamrog, a word that refers to the plant's three leaves. Legend says that St. Patrick used the shamrock to visually illustrate the concept of the Trinity to explain Christianity to the pagan kings in 432 A.D.
There is a traditional belief that wearing it will bring good fortune and the luck of the Irish. The legend of the Shamrock lives on today in our quality Irish craftsmanship.
